Origins

Ovens are kitchen appliances that are used to bake and roast food in homes across the world. They typically are powered by electricity or gas, with models that use bottle gas available in some markets however ovens can additionally use other fuels such as wood or charcoal. In many homes the best oven is usually surrounded with a hob which is where food can be cooked. A hob is a burner that can be turned on and off. An oven is a closed space which heats food in the middle.

The first ovens were massive brick and mud structures that contained fire in order to heat food. They were used for baking bread, cooking meat, and for cooking other foods because they held heat well and maintained a constant temperature. They could also be easily shared between family members. The open pits and ovens had three major flaws They were dangerous due to the smoke and flames that could be seen from them, they used a lot fuel (wood) and they were difficult to control the heat and the cooking process.

The solution was to make ovens look like fireplaces. They included a chimney to block off the fire, reducing its intensity and the amount of smoke. This made it easier to manage. These were popular in the 16th and 17th centuries and were typically found in household that were wealthy enough to have a separate kitchen with a chimney, as well as having more than one oven and fireplace.

By the mid-19th Century, European ovens were a popular feature in kitchens. It was partly due to the fact that the oven was essential. It was safer and more efficient for people to cook their food over an open fire or in a cauldron. It is believed that the advent of the oven was correlated with changes in cooking style and recipes, which resulted in an increased concentration on meat and casseroles.

It is important to note that in certain recipes, like those from Nigella she suggests cooking a pot "on the hob" but this can be misleading as hob is actually a British term for stove top. The North American equivalent is a cooktop or range, so it could be confusing if you are not familiar with British terminology.

Functions

Oven functions, or cooking modes, are pre-programmed settings that control the way in which the oven's heating elements as well as the fan operate depending on your recipe. They are designed to allow you to cook food more efficiently and effectively while also preserving the flavor and texture.

Most ovens come with a conventional mode that heats from the top and bottom to bake or roast food. There is also a fan-assisted option that uses an integrated fan to circulate air around the oven, allowing for more uniform and faster heating. There are a variety of options for oven and hob functions. It is important to understand the differences to decide which one is best ovens and hobs for you.

The fan-powered function of the oven is perfect to cook a variety of meals. It is able to heat the oven more evenly than a traditional oven, and is ideal for baking, grilling, and roasting. It is especially useful for pizzas and pies that require a quick crisp and smooth finish. The Fan-Assisted setting comes with a zigzag on top and a line at the bottom. It can save up to 40% of cooking time.

Some ovens come with grilling features that combine the heat from the bottom of the oven with the top to give your meals a delicious char. This mode is perfect for meat and vegetable kebabs and is marked with zigzag lines and straight lines, similar to Fan-Assisted. This is usually placed on the lower shelf of the oven. Be sure to check the temperature settings in your oven to ensure that you don't overcook.

There are additional oven functions like bread and pastry proofing slow cooking, baking, and other things. These ovens are usually programmed to create a warm and controlled environment that will facilitate the rise of dough and allow your food to develop great flavor.

There are ovens with Steam functions that are ideal for making healthy, nutritious food. It offers a moderate amount of moisture to your food, which preserves tenderness and adds a delicate, rich taste to your poultry, vegetables, baked goods and even custards. It's just as simple as pouring the water into the reservoir inside your oven, then turning it on, with some models even automatically changing the amount of steam depending on the temperature you select.

Types

There are a variety of ovens and hobs that are available on the market. They are available in a variety of styles, from traditional gas models to contemporary electric models. It is crucial to select the oven and hob that meets your requirements. It is worthwhile to think about features like self-cleaning or intelligent capabilities too.

Gas best ovens and hobs uk work well in many kitchens and are a very popular option. They are simple to use because they come with rings on the burners as well as a grate where pans rest that emits heat. Gas hobs are also energy-efficient and provide precise temperature control. This could help you lower your energy bills. They may take longer to heat up than electric hobs, and they can be more difficult to clean with dirt.

Electric hobs oven are available in a range of designs including induction and ceramic. Induction hobs are a bit more expensive, but they are more energy efficient as the hob only is heated when you put the pot on it. They are also safe for children and are able to heat fairly quickly. They can also be slow to cool off and do not warm up evenly.

Plate hobs, which are an essential kitchen appliance, have an array of cooking zones that are all electrically powered on an even surface. They are placed beneath the cabinets in your kitchen. They provide a stylish, modern appearance that look elegant and fit in with the majority of kitchens. They are difficult to clean since they have a variety of zones with uneven heating. If they are not properly cleaned they could leave burn marks.

The most popular model is the built-in single oven. They can be set up on top of a stove, or at eye-level in an built-in cabinet. They are often big enough to accommodate a large meal and can come in various sizes, so be certain to consider your family's size when you choose an oven. They can also be found with additional options, such as a grill or a steam function.

Installation

It may be worth hiring an electrician to set up the new oven for you or to replace an old one. This will ensure that the electrical circuit is properly installed and that your new appliance is safe to use. An experienced electrician will be able to follow local regulations to ensure that your installation is compliant with all safety regulations.

Before beginning the process of fitting your new electric oven and hob, you'll need to have all the required equipment and tools on hand. This includes wire nuts, electrical tape, a screwdriver and a tester for electrical circuits and conduit. Make sure you check the electrical supply at your home to make sure it is able to handle an electric hob or oven.

cookology-built-in-electric-single-fan-oven-in-stainless-steel-with-minute-minder-cof600ss-2-medium.jpgThe first step in the process of installing a new cooktop and oven is to remove any old appliances. To do this, locate the bolts or screws that hold the old appliance and remove them with care. After the appliance is removed, the space where the new one is installed must be clean and free of obstructions. Then a junction box will need to be installed and connected to the electrical supply using conduit. This should be done in accordance with the instructions of the manufacturer and any applicable local regulations.

Once electrical connections are completed after which the oven and hob can be lowered into place. The fitter will utilize the clips that came along with the hob in order to secure it and ensure it's flush with the worktop. The fitter will then test the hob to ensure it is operating properly.

If you're planning to install a gas hob and oven, it's a good idea to engage a professional to do the job. Gas installation is not as easy as plugging in an electric oven. A CORGI certified engineer must connect the pipes. It's also an excellent idea to get a cooker hood installed in case you don't have one, as it can help in ventilating your kitchen and is required by Part F of the Building Regulations.
